On Sunday, April 13, three former Eastview Senior High School standouts, including Aimee Christenson, Alexa Christenson and Payton Prissel’s current college team, the Bemidji State Beavers, lost 4-2 in their NCAA Division II softball game against the Augustana Vikings.

The game took place at Bowden Field. This was their second matchup against the Vikings this season.

The Beavers’ next game is scheduled for Friday, April 18 at 1 p.m. at BSU Softball Field against Minot State Beavers.
